默认是0的。 数组是一种线性表数据结构。它用一组连续的内存空间,来存储一组具有相同类型的数据。线性表就是数据排成像一条线一样的结构。每个线性表上的数据。
C语言中定义的局部变量如果没有初始化,其值是未定义的,不能以任何有意义的方式使用。如果该变量是静态存储类变量或全局变量,则其默认初始化值为0。被初始化为。
默认是0的。 数组是一种线性表数据结构。它用一组连续的内存空间,来存储一组具有相同类型的数据。线性表就是数据排成像一条线一样的结构。每个线性表上的数据。
只创建不赋值的,默认为0 只创建不赋值的,默认为0
默认是0。 一般来说在main前定义的数组默认值都为0。 如果想要在函数内定义数组中所有的值都默认成为0的话,只需在定义数组时这样写:int num[2][2]={0};这样数。
对结构体struct a // a为结构体名{ int b; // 两个int型的结构体变量 int c;}初始化方式主要有以下几种:struct a a1 = { .b 。
结构体数组在定义的同时也可以初始化,例如:struct stu{char *name; //姓名int num; //学号int age; //年龄char group; //所在小组floa。
要是在C++里定义的话,娄组的下标是0.元素的默认初值看定义的类型,static、全局变量系统默认为0;局部变量就随机了。 要是在C++里定义的话,娄组的下标是0.元素。
问题一:关于数组正确的说法是 A 解释: A、数组可以自定义长度,某户面向对象语言不可以动态定义数组长度。 B、数组的元素必须一致 C、for循环可以实。
在C语言中,自动变量的数组,其元素的值在未初始化前是不确定的; 静态变量的数组,其元素在未初始化其,是有初始值的,如int a[2]如果是在各个函数之外,其元素...
回顶部 |